Wild Things: Glad to see the return of swifts
Briefly

Those masters of the skies have re-appeared over my house to signal the genuine start of summer... How amazing they do everything on the wing including eating, drinking, and mating, never stopping until they have located their previous nest sites in brickwork or beneath house eaves.
Breeding swift pairs dropped from 85,000 to 59,000 since 2000... House owners often block swift access when refurbishing, endangering the birds' survival.
